Ingredients

For the Filling

  • Breakfast sausage
  • Eggs
  • Milk
  • Salt
  • Black pepper
  • Butter
  • Shredded cheddar or Colby Jack cheese

For the Roll-Ups

  • Large flour tortillas or crescent roll dough
  • Butter, melted (for brushing)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Cook breakfast sausage in a skillet over medium heat until browned. Drain excess grease.
  3. In a bowl, whisk eggs with milk, salt, and pepper.
  4. Melt butter in a skillet and scramble eggs gently until just set.
  5. Warm tortillas slightly to make them flexible, or unroll crescent dough.
  6. Spoon sausage and eggs evenly onto each wrap.
  7. Sprinkle shredded cheese over the filling.
  8. Roll tightly and place seam-side down on the baking sheet.
  9. Brush tops lightly with melted butter.
  10. Bake 12–15 minutes until golden and warmed through.
  11. Cool slightly before serving or storing.

Make-Ahead and Meal Prep Benefits

These roll-ups are designed for efficiency:

  • Prepare and bake in advance
  • Refrigerate up to 4 days
  • Freeze individually wrapped roll-ups for up to 2 months

They reheat well in the oven, air fryer, or microwave.


Variations to Customize

  • Add sautéed bell peppers or onions
  • Swap sausage for bacon or ham
  • Use pepper jack cheese for spice
  • Try whole wheat tortillas for extra fiber

Vegetarian versions work by replacing sausage with mushrooms or spinach.

Storage and Reheating Tips

  • Refrigerate in airtight container
  • Freeze individually wrapped in foil
  • Reheat at 350°F for 10 minutes or microwave for 1–2 minutes

Avoid overheating to keep eggs tender.

Sausage, Egg and Cheese Breakfast Roll-Ups

Savory breakfast roll-ups filled with fluffy eggs, sausage, and melted cheese.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ings: 8 roll-ups
Course: Breakfast,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 340

Ingredients
  

Filling
  • 1 lb breakfast sausage
  • 6 eggs
  • 2 tbsp milk
  • 0.5 tsp salt
  • 0.25 tsp black pepper
  • 1 cup shredded cheese cheddar or Colby Jack
Wraps
  • 8 large flour tortillas
  • 2 tbsp butter melted

Equipment

  • Mixing bowls
  • Skillet
  • Baking sheet
  • Whisk

Method
 

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) and line baking sheet.
  2. Cook sausage until browned and drain excess grease.
  3. Whisk eggs with milk, salt, and pepper.
  4. Scramble eggs gently until just set.
  5. Fill tortillas with sausage, eggs, and cheese.
  6. Roll tightly and place seam-side down.
  7. Brush with melted butter.
  8. Bake 12–15 minutes until golden.

Notes

Freeze individually for easy reheating.
